The rosé wine La Fleur Saint-Michel Rosé Côtes de Gascogne IGP, vintage 2015 from the winery Plaimont has been rated in 2016 by Axel Biesler und Marco Lindauer with 88 Falstaff points. It is a wine made from the region South West France in France.
Tasting Notes
Refreshing bouquet of wild strawberries, raspberries and lemon balm. Animating composition of fresh herbs and fine forest fruits. Delicately fruity taste with soft acidity and a fine tannic grip. Provides honest drinking pleasure without a break.
